BDD / TDD assertion framework for node.js and the browser that can be paired with any testing framework.
toThrow
by @43081j in https://github.com/chaijs/chai/pull/1609
Full Changelog: https://github.com/chaijs/chai/compare/v5.1.0...v5.1.1
iterable
assertion by @koddsson in https://github.com/chaijs/chai/pull/1592
Full Changelog: https://github.com/chaijs/chai/compare/v5.0.3...v5.1.0
Fix bad v5.0.2 publish.
Full Changelog: https://github.com/chaijs/chai/compare/v5.0.2...v5.0.3
bump-cli
by @koddsson in https://github.com/chaijs/chai/pull/1559
??
for node compat (5.x) by @43081j in https://github.com/chaijs/chai/pull/1576
loupe
to latest version by @koddsson in https://github.com/chaijs/chai/pull/1579
Full Changelog: https://github.com/chaijs/chai/compare/v5.0.1...v5.0.2
??
for node compat by @43081j in https://github.com/chaijs/chai/pull/1574
Full Changelog: https://github.com/chaijs/chai/compare/v4.4.0...v4.4.1
Full Changelog: https://github.com/chaijs/chai/compare/v4.3.10...v4.4.0
import {...} from 'chai'
or import('chai')
. require('chai')
will cause failures in nodejs. If you're using ESM and seeing failures, it may be due to a bundler or transpiler which is incorrectly converting import statements into require calls.get-func-name
dependency by @koddsson in https://github.com/chaijs/chai/pull/1416
deep-eql
to latest version by @koddsson in https://github.com/chaijs/chai/pull/1542
type-detect
as a simple function by @koddsson in https://github.com/chaijs/chai/pull/1544
assertion-error
to it's latest major version! by @koddsson in https://github.com/chaijs/chai/pull/1543
Full Changelog: https://github.com/chaijs/chai/compare/4.3.1...v5.0.0
The first Release Candidate of chai@v5 is here!
We've put out a few alpha versions and tested them out in various projects with good success. This RC includes all those changes plus any fixes that we've discovered since then.
Please try it out in your projects and let us know if you run into any issues so we can make fixes before version 5!
Thanks for using Chai 🙏🏻
get-func-name
dependency by @koddsson in https://github.com/chaijs/chai/pull/1416
deep-eql
to latest version by @koddsson in https://github.com/chaijs/chai/pull/1542
type-detect
as a simple function by @koddsson in https://github.com/chaijs/chai/pull/1544
assertion-error
to it's latest major version! by @koddsson in https://github.com/chaijs/chai/pull/1543
Full Changelog: https://github.com/chaijs/chai/compare/v4.3.10...v5.0.0-rc.0
deep-eql
to latest version by @koddsson in https://github.com/chaijs/chai/pull/1542
type-detect
as a simple function by @koddsson in https://github.com/chaijs/chai/pull/1544
assertion-error
to it's latest major version! by @koddsson in https://github.com/chaijs/chai/pull/1543
Full Changelog: https://github.com/chaijs/chai/compare/v5.0.0-alpha.1...v5.0.0-alpha.2
This release simply bumps all dependencies to their latest non-breaking versions.
Full Changelog: https://github.com/chaijs/chai/compare/v4.3.9...v4.3.10